摘要
为消除复合温度传感器所形成的在线黑体空腔"不等温性"和"非密闭性"对测量的影响,采用矩形区域近似法进行了不等温有效发射率的计算。在分析传感器几何特性、材料发射率、温度分布和环境温度对有效发射率影响的基础上,给出了传感器结构的优化参数。实验表明:优化后的传感器具有较高灵敏度和准确度。
In order to eliminate the error of non-isothermalness and non-airtightness of online blackbody cavity,calculation formulas for non-isothermalness effective emissivity of compound temperature sensor are presented by using rectangular-region approximation. On the basis of factors analysis of structure, material emissivity,temperature distribution and surrounding temperature, the sensor's optimum parameters are obtained.The optimum parameters can improve the sensitivity and accuracy.
